A slot is a thin opening or groove in something. Usually, a slot is used to fit or slide a piece into. It can also be the space between two things.

A slot machine is a type of gambling machine that accepts coins as payment. It typically has a set number of paylines and a jackpot, but it may also have special symbols that trigger bonuses or features.

There are many types of slot machines, including penny slots and high-end games. Some have jackpots that are thousands of dollars and others have bonus games that can give players free spins and even cash prizes.

Penny slots are popular because they can be played with little money, but they can still offer a lot of fun and excitement to players. However, it’s important to choose a game with a high RTP (return to player), as this will give you better odds of winning and more frequent payouts.

High-end slots are also popular because they offer a lot of variety, from the traditional three-reel machine to the latest video-slots with more than twenty paylines and exciting features like bonus rounds and free spins. Slot receivers are a necessity in the NFL today, but there are some teams that thrive with this position more than others. These teams are known for their ability to stretch out the field and attack all levels of the defense.

Typically, slot receivers line up pre-snap between the last man on the line of scrimmage and the outside receiver. This gives them more opportunities to make a play, especially in the open field where they can catch passes and run out of bounds.

These players have a wide range of skills, and their versatility makes them valuable to any offense. Some of the best slot receivers in the NFL are Tyreek Hill, Cole Beasley, Keenan Allen, and Tyler Lockett.

They can go up, in, or out of the box and are excellent with short passes. They can also be a great blocker and help to protect the quarterback.

The slot receiver is a position that has come into popularity in recent years, and many teams are now utilizing them more frequently than ever before. These players are versatile, and their positional knowledge will help them make the most of their talent on the field.
